Set Up a Schedule for Keyword Blocking and Outbound Firewall Rules

You can set up a schedule that you can apply to keyword blocking (see Use Keywords to Block Internet Sites on page 105) and outbound firewall rules (see Manage Outbound Firewall Rules for Services and Applications on page 179).

If applied, the schedule specifies the days and time that keyword blocking, outbound firewall rules, or both are active.

By default, no schedule is set and you can either enable or disable these features.

To set up a schedule for blocking:

1.Launch an Internet browser from a computer or WiFi device that is connected to the network.

2.Type http://www.routerlogin.net.
